How to Prepare Herbal Infusions
Stepbystep guide on brewing herbal infusions for optimal benefits. Tips for selecting quality herbs and ingredients.Brewing herbal infusions is like making a warm hug in a mug! First, gather your favorite herbs—think chamomile for calm or peppermint for pep. Use about 1 teaspoon of dried herbs or 2 teaspoons of fresh herbs for each cup of water. Boil water in a pot, then add the herbs. Let them steep for 5-10 minutes to release their magic. Strain and enjoy! Remember, quality matters. Choose organic herbs for the best flavor.

Potential Risks and Considerations
Discussion of contraindications and when to avoid specific herbs. Importance of consulting healthcare professionals before starting herbal routines.Using herbal infusions can be fun, but be careful! Some herbs might not mix well with certain medicines. If you’re pregnant or have health issues, it’s best to steer clear. Always check in with a healthcare professional before starting any herbal routine. They can help you find the right herbs that won’t turn you into a walking science experiment!
Herb | Contraindications |
---|---|
Kava | Risk of liver damage |
St. John’s Wort | May interfere with many medications |
Valerian | Can cause drowsiness |
